One of the symbols of Bombay (and India as a whole) is a monument to Gateway of India, or the Gateway of India. Much has been written about it in guidebooks and will not be repeated. Let me just say that these massive gate in the heart of Bombay were built by the British in 1924 as a symbol of colonial grandeur and the conquest of India. Ironic fact that only 23 years after the last British soldiers hastily left India after its independence.

In contrast to India Gate stands the classic and the most expensive accommodation «Taj Mahal Palace», also a business card of Bombay. Among other things, to the British on has nothing to do and was built in 1903, the richest man in India and the founder of the corporation Tata (virtually the entire industry in India is part of his empire) Dzhamshedzhi Nasservandzhi Tata. It is believed that he was being insulted disrespectful attitude towards them (because of the color of the skin) by subservient Hotel in London, decided to create a chic hotel of this level, which is not seen in Europe. And he did it; at the beginning of the XX century, it was definitely one of the best hotels in the world.

November 26, 2008 Hotel Taj Mahal Palace turned into an arena of bloody drama when dozens of Islamic militants attacked a hotel and took hostage a lot of tourists. During the storm at the Indian army and the police, 37 people were killed, and the building was severely damaged, following a couple of photos of the day - 55,179,090

In my opinion, the main train station in Bombay, Victoria Terminus (today renamed Chhatrapati Shivaji Terminus), is the most beautiful monument of architecture of Mumbai. Moreover, obezdili bunch of countries, I have never seen such a magnificent station -

The station was built by the British in 1887 in honor of Queen Victoria's Golden Jubilee. It is logical that for the Indians this "remarkable" day has absolutely no value, but rather reminiscent of colonialism. But the building itself perfectly agree!
